Nashik city recorded a disturbing series of events, with three murders occurring within a span of 24 hours, as reported by officials on Wednesday. The grim happenings highlight underlying social issues tied to substance abuse and mental health.

The first incident unfolded in Old Satpur Colony, where 60-year-old Mangala Gawali was tragically killed by her son, Swapnil. Authorities disclosed that this act of violence was fueled by his dependence on alcohol after she refused to give him money.

In another unsettling case in the Bhagva Chowk area, Arvind Patil, 57, who suffers from mental health problems, strangled his 85-year-old mother, Yashodabai. Subsequently, he went to the Nashik Road police station to report his actions. The third murder involved a fatal attack on 40-year-old Amol Shankarrao Meshram, over a property dispute, by a duo involving a minor and 21-year-old Kunal Saude.
